Exterior Design

The Volvo XC40 has a confident and modern exterior design. It stands out from many compact SUVs thanks to its upright shape, strong shoulder lines and clean Scandinavian styling. The design is stylish without looking overly aggressive, which gives the XC40 a mature and premium character.
At the front, the XC40 features Volvo’s distinctive grille, sharp headlights and a strong bumper design. From the side, the raised ride height, compact proportions and squared-off profile give it a practical SUV look. At the rear, the vertical light design and wide tailgate make the XC40 instantly recognisable as a Volvo.
Depending on trim level, used models may include larger alloy wheels, LED headlights, contrast roof colours, roof rails, privacy glass and sportier R-Design or Plus/Ultimate styling details. The XC40 looks premium without being too flashy, which is part of its appeal.
Interior Quality and Comfort

Inside, the Volvo XC40 feels calm, comfortable and well designed. The cabin has a simple Scandinavian layout, with clean lines, supportive seats and practical storage areas. It may not feel as sporty as some German rivals, but it has a warm, relaxed and premium atmosphere.
Front passengers get plenty of space, and the seats are especially comfortable for longer journeys. Rear passenger space is good for a compact SUV, making the XC40 suitable for couples, small families and drivers who regularly carry passengers.
Comfort is one of the XC40’s biggest strengths. The ride is generally smooth, the cabin feels refined, and the raised driving position gives the driver a clear view of the road. Higher-spec used models may include leather upholstery, heated seats, electric seat adjustment, panoramic roof, dual-zone climate control, ambient lighting and upgraded audio systems.
Technology and Infotainment
The Volvo XC40 offers a modern and practical technology package. Most versions include a central portrait-style infotainment touchscreen, digital driver display and smartphone connectivity. The cabin layout keeps the dashboard clean, while the screen controls many of the car’s main functions.
Depending on year and trim, used models may include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, satellite navigation, Bluetooth, wireless phone charging, reversing camera, parking sensors, connected services and premium audio.
Newer Volvo models may use Google-based infotainment, which gives access to features such as Google Maps, Google Assistant and app-based services. Older versions still feel modern, but buyers should compare model years carefully because infotainment systems and software can vary.

Performance and Driving Experience
The Volvo XC40 is designed to feel comfortable, secure and easy to drive. It is not the sportiest compact SUV in its class, but it feels refined, stable and reassuring in everyday use.
Around town, the XC40 is easy to manage thanks to its compact size, good visibility and light steering. The raised seating position makes it simple to place on the road, while parking sensors and cameras make tighter spaces easier to handle.
On motorways, the XC40 feels calm and composed. It is well suited to longer journeys, especially with the more powerful petrol, diesel, hybrid or electric versions found on the used market. The suspension is tuned more for comfort than sharp handling, which suits the car’s relaxed character.
Some used XC40 models are available with all-wheel drive, while others use front-wheel drive. All-wheel-drive versions can provide extra confidence in wet weather or on rural roads, but front-wheel-drive models are usually more efficient and often cheaper to run.
Safety Features
Safety is one of Volvo’s strongest selling points, and the XC40 reflects that reputation. Many used models include a strong range of driver assistance systems, including automatic emergency braking, lane keeping assistance, traffic sign recognition, cruise control and multiple airbags.
Depending on year and trim, additional features may include blind spot monitoring, rear cross-traffic alert, adaptive cruise control, parking cameras and more advanced driver assistance systems.
The XC40 feels reassuring on the road thanks to its strong structure, good visibility and stable handling. For family buyers, commuters and safety-conscious drivers, this is one of the main reasons to consider it over some rivals.
As always, used buyers should check the exact safety equipment fitted to the individual car, as specification can vary between trims and model years.
Practicality and Cargo Space

The Volvo XC40 is practical for a compact premium SUV. It offers a useful boot, wide-opening doors and a cabin designed around everyday convenience. The boot is suitable for shopping, luggage, school bags or weekend trips, while folding the rear seats creates extra room for larger items.
The cabin includes clever storage solutions, including large door bins, useful centre console storage and space for phones, drinks and daily essentials. This makes the XC40 feel especially easy to live with.
It is not as spacious as a larger SUV such as the Volvo XC60, but it is easier to park and more manageable in towns and cities. For small families, couples, commuters and drivers upgrading from a hatchback, the XC40 offers a strong balance of practicality and compact dimensions.
Fuel Economy / Engine Options

The Volvo XC40 has been offered with a wide range of powertrains, depending on year and market. Used buyers may find petrol, diesel, mild hybrid, plug-in hybrid and fully electric versions.
Petrol models are usually suitable for lower-mileage drivers and mixed use. Diesel versions may suit higher-mileage motorway drivers, although they are less common in newer model years. Mild hybrid models offer improved efficiency without needing to plug in. Plug-in hybrid versions can be very efficient for short journeys if charged regularly.
Fully electric versions were previously sold as XC40 Recharge, while newer electric Volvo compact SUV naming may use the EX40 badge. Buyers considering an electric model should check battery size, charging speed, range and warranty status carefully.
Before buying a used Volvo XC40, check:
- Service history
- NCT status
- Mileage
- Engine, hybrid or battery condition
- Tyre and brake wear
- Gearbox operation
- Trim level and optional extras
- Warranty status
- Whether it is petrol, diesel, mild hybrid, plug-in hybrid or electric
- Whether the powertrain suits your driving pattern

Pros and Cons
Pros
The Volvo XC40 is stylish, comfortable and very safe. It has a distinctive design, a relaxing cabin and practical storage solutions. It feels premium without being too flashy, and the wide choice of used powertrains gives buyers plenty of flexibility.
Cons
The XC40 is not the sportiest compact SUV to drive. Some rivals offer sharper handling or more advanced infotainment systems. Higher-spec models can be expensive on the used market, and plug-in hybrid or electric versions require careful checks of battery condition and charging history.
